Path loss Optimization in WIMAX Network using Genetic Algorithm
2020
Iraqi Journal of Computer, Communication, Control and System Engineering
The most necessary factors effect on the standard of broadband access services in mobile systems are WIMAX signal throughput and area coverage range. The environment controls are based on the sign power of any radio communication system. The sign power in any base station site relies on the space between the transmitter and the receiver, carrier frequency for the transmitter and the receiver along on the path loss.
